After K2 UPDATE Menue Crashed

GK User
Sun Sep 04, 2016 12:50 pm
Hello,

after the Updade from K2 2.7.0 to 2.7.1 our Menue structure complete crashed. Most of the entrys are lost and not possiblity to
reconstruct over the Backend. We check the menu options in the template manger too.

Look into the pictures Please. Before and After.
Bildschirmfoto-2016-09-04-um-13.39.53.jpg

Bildschirmfoto-2016-09-04-um-13.35.57.jpg


It was fine you have any fix for that.
User avatar
Gold Boarder

teitbite
Wed Sep 07, 2016 6:45 am
Hi

I think this is a bug in K2. I have experienced it as well, but in my case it was just one menu link disappeared, so I'm simply created it again. Unfortunately this bug is in database, so some of the menu elements may be affected. Please contact K2 support, they may know how to deal with it already.
User avatar
Moderator

GK User
Wed Sep 07, 2016 1:54 pm
Thanks for Response.

I had do that and the K2 Support is working on it on my page.

Michael
User avatar
Gold Boarder

teitbite
Sat Sep 10, 2016 2:15 pm
Hi

Ok. Great to hear that. Please let me know what was the fix to problem.
User avatar
Moderator

GK User
Tue Sep 27, 2016 1:17 pm
Bad news,

K2 Support dont can fix the menu Problem after Update to a new Version of K2.
It must be a Template Issue. With other Templates K2 Update and the Menu works fine.
K2 copy a complete mirror of our Page over Akeeba and check all. Database entries and more
Now we will change the Template "Writer" to a other Garvick Template without K2.

If you have any Idea, please let me know.

Best Regards
Michael
User avatar
Gold Boarder

teitbite
Wed Sep 28, 2016 10:44 am
Hi

Template has nothing to do with menu. It does not have a database table on it's own. K2 stores multiple elements in database, so during update some tables are altered. I do not know exactly which one, and what changes are done, but I've already experienced same issue couple of times and it was with a templates from different providers. (For example: I maintenance a website based on T3 framework and after every K2 update Contuct Us link is missing).

The only way I've dealt with it was by adding this missing menu elements again.
User avatar
Moderator

GK User
Wed Sep 28, 2016 11:17 am
Jepp i know ;-)

Here my Workflow to fix the Issue.

Backup of my site with Akeeba.
Reinstall with akeeba on a new URL to run tests.
-In this way i do update to php 7
Make a copy of my menu_table with phpadmin and download the copy to my PC

Install the new K2 Version and take a look
Same result (Shi....)

Delete the menu_table from the new database
- import the old copy of my menu_table
- Browser reload

works !!!

In the working domain i update to the newest K2 version
- delete the now exist menu_table
- import the saved menu_table

works !!!

best
michael

teitbite wrote:Hi

Template has nothing to do with menu. It does not have a database table on it's own. K2 stores multiple elements in database, so during update some tables are altered. I do not know exactly which one, and what changes are done, but I've already experienced same issue couple of times and it was with a templates from different providers. (For example: I maintenance a website based on T3 framework and after every K2 update Contuct Us link is missing).

The only way I've dealt with it was by adding this missing menu elements again.
User avatar
Gold Boarder

teitbite
Sat Oct 01, 2016 5:40 pm
Hi

So that's just confirmed what I was thinking. K2 update is changing menu_table. Good to know old table still works with newest joomla. Thank You.
User avatar
Moderator


cron
Remember me
Register New Account
If you are old Gavick user, click HERE for steps to retrieve your account.